Safe towing begins with making certain the tow automobile is ideal to tow the trailer. You can pick the right trailer or caravan to match your tow automobile or get a tow automobile to suit your trailer type and towing needs. While modern vehicles are lighter and provide much better service for normal motoring, some do not have the necessary characteristics for towing.

You might tow only 1 trailer (campers, box or boat) at once. Individuals should not ride in trailers/caravans. A removable tow combining can be removed when not in usage. This will certainly avoid obstructing the number plate and minimise the risk to individuals walking behind the lorry. When hauling a trailer (consisting of campers), remember to: enable the additional size and size of the trailer when entering trafficallow for its propensity to 'cut in' on corners and curvesaccelerate, brake and steer smoothly and carefully to avoid swayingallow for the impacts of cross-winds, passing website traffic and irregular roadway surfacesleave a longer quiting range in between you and the automobile ahead; boost the gap for longer, much heavier trailers and allow much more distance in poor driving conditionsuse a reduced gear in both hands-on and automated cars when travelling downhill to make your vehicle easier to manage and reduce the strain on your brakesallow even more time and range to overtake and prevent 'removing' the car you are surpassing when going back to the left lanefit a reversing cam or get a person to watch the rear of the trailer when you reversereversing is hard and takes practicenot hold up trafficpull off the road where it is secure to do so, and where it will not create a build-up of web traffic unable to overtakebe conscious that important site your automobile and trailer will tend to persuade when a hefty lorry overtakes you.

A trailer with one axle group near the middle of the tons. Part of the load rests on the tow drawback of the pulling car. A trailer with 2 axle teams. The front axle group is steered by connection to the tow vehicle (Towing Near Me). A lot of the tons rests on the trailer.
The tow drawback is in front of the back axle of the tow lorry. It's vital to choose the ideal trailer kind and setup for less complicated load distribution and restraint. Your vehicle needs to be equipped appropriately for the trailer's type and size, consisting of: tow bars and couplings of a suitable type and capacityelectrical sockets for lightingsuitable brake links if requiredextra mirrors for hauling huge trailers if requiredoptional rear-view camerathese help to see web traffic behind you yet do not replace the demand for mirrors.

Guarantee the lots is appropriately safeguarded to the trailer. Preserve all your towing tools on a regular basis, including automobile and trailer, to ensure secure towing. Ask your trailer or car supplier, RACQ or other qualified solution representative to inspect that the: lugging car and trailer are in a roadworthy and secure conditiontrailer's wheel bearings, suspension and brakes are in great working condition.
